
The Americas Stage 1 group stage is done. Six teams make the playoffs, three of them will book tickets to Masters London - and the bracket already has some fascinating first-round matchups.
Upper Bracket Favorites
MIBR and KRÜ Esports enter directly into the Upper Bracket Semifinals, the two sides that looked most consistent across group play. MIBR get the FURIA vs Leviatán winner, while KRÜ face whoever comes through G2 vs 100 Thieves. KRÜ finished as the only team to go undefeated through groups - they're the bracket's biggest threat and they get to prove it from the top.

Lower Bracket Danger
NRG and LOUD drop into the Lower Bracket, which means the world champions need to run the gauntlet just to reach London. One loss and they're done. LOUD earned their spot with that Leviatán upset but now face an immediate elimination threat against a wounded NRG side that, based on the Sentinels win, is starting to find form at exactly the right time.

Playoffs run May 14 to 24 in a double-elimination format. All matches are Bo3 except the Lower Bracket Final and Grand Final, which go to Bo5. Top three finishers qualify for Masters London - and first place also earns a spot at the Esports World Cup.
